Early Intervention Technical Assistance (EITA) Early Intervention Technical Assistance (EITA) provides training and technical assistance to local Infant/Toddler and Preschool Early Intervention programs providing support and services to children birth to school age with developmental disabilities and their families. Did you know there is a day just for celebrating friends? It’s called International Friendship Day! Every year on July 30th, people around the world take time to appreciate their friends and the important role friendship plays in their lives. This year, we are celebrating the 25th anniversary of the Olmstead Decision. I am personally grateful to the United States Supreme Court for the impact this has on my life.
